Graduation Rates at Vanderbilt

At Vanderbilt University, the graduation rates was 92.77% (1,476 students out of 1,591 candidates were completed their degree within 150% normal time. For example, within 6 years for students seeking a 4-year bachelors degree.). By gender, 682 male and 794 female students have graduated from the school last year by completing their jobs in the period.

Non-resident Alien Graduation Rates

Non-resident alien student is not a US citizen and studies with student visa, such as F visa, in United States. At Vanderbilt University, 101 of 118 non-resident alien students completed their courses within 150% normal time and the graduation rate was 85.59%.

Retention Rate

By definition, retention rate is the percentage of students who return to a college for their sophomore year. At Vanderbilt University, the retention rate is 96% for full-time students and 100 % for part-time students.
